LEGO 802-3 Player Piano is a Samsonite Basic Set released in 1964, containing 90 pieces. It depicts a small upright piano build and is notable as the first LEGO piano-themed set. The set was manufactured by Samsonite and sold exclusively in the United States and Canada. Packaging used a cardboard backing typical of early Samsonite-era releases, and the parts assortment includes early elements such as hollow-bottom bricks and waffle-bottom plates.
